Radeon R5 430 vs GeForce GTX 750 Ti benchmarks
For gaming, the GeForce GTX 750 Ti graphics card is better than the Radeon R5 430 in our tests.
Our database shows that the GeForce GTX 750 Ti has a slightly higher core clock speed. The core clock speed (or base speed) is the frequency at which the GPU core runs. This metric makes sense when comparing GPUs of a similar architecture or generation. In addition, the GeForce GTX 750 Ti also has a slightly higher boost clock speed: the maximum frequency the chip can reach if power delivery and thermals allow.
In addition, the Radeon R5 430 has a slightly lower TDP at 50 W when compared to the GeForce GTX 750 Ti at 60 W. This is not a measure of performance, but rather the amount of heat generated by the chip when running at its highest speed.
According to the results of the hardwareDB benchmark utility, the GeForce GTX 750 Ti is faster than the Radeon R5 430.
